Analysis

Switzerland recorded 860.62 billion current LCU for gni in 2025. That is the highest value across all 66 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 4.0% on the previous year and up 25.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, gni in Switzerland peaked at 860.62 billion current LCU in 2025 and was at its lowest, 44.46 billion current LCU, in 1960.

Switzerland ranks 107th of 209 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Gross national income is the total income earned by all residents within an economic territory during an accounting period. It is equal to gross domestic product plus earned income receivable from abroad minus earned income payable abroad.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This series is expressed in local currency units.
